Output 58c04be2a9a27c7f539eb2c334fe3b943f3a3816ad8f94fc8a548e01b3fcbaad:69

value
3326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ce2a3d629f117ba9d30ee3129c2ceaaf313aefc3467db0867a095fd5e5abbff7
address
bc1pec4r6c5lz9a6n5cwuvffct824ucn4m7rge7mppn6p90atedthlmsr2xs4y
transaction
58c04be2a9a27c7f539eb2c334fe3b943f3a3816ad8f94fc8a548e01b3fcbaad
spent
true